## Lintwall Baseline

The baseline file (`lintwall.baseline.json`) pins known findings so new ones fail the build. Do not hand-edit it; regenerate with `lintwall snapshot` after triage. Release cuts must upload the refreshed baseline to the Corvette artifact service before tagging. The uploader reads its credential from the release environment, not from the repo. For the current cycle, use the key below.

API key for fahip-kahip: zpat23_XiJGUHz5xfaAtaIqUkus0rh

# Clock skew handling for Forgeline build agents.
# Support: when customers report "build finished before it started,"
# it's skew between agents, not corruption. The scheduler tolerates
# drift up to a threshold, warns in a middle band, and quarantines
# agents beyond it. Do not raise limits to silence tickets; fix NTP
# on the agent instead. Thresholds are defined below.

limits module of haweg-badug:
RATE_LIMITS = {
    "casox": 339,
    "wenix": 653,
    "rusok": 650,
    "lamix": 337,
    "aldvan": 753,
}

Changelog — Driftgate agents, v2.9. Renamed AGENT_TIME_TOKEN to AGENT_SKEW_TOKEN to clarify it gates the clock-skew correction service between build agents. On-call: if agents report skew above 400ms, confirm the new name is in the pool env file. The old key is ignored as of this release. Directly below the renamed entry, the file must set the signing secret.

env line for fafof-fahag: LEDGER_TOKEN5=f8790

## Break-glass: Corvid broker upgrade

For release managers only. If the Corvid message broker upgrade stalls mid-rollout and normal admin auth is down, use break-glass access. Scope: cluster restart and version rollback only. Every use is logged and reviewed within 24 hours by the Ashgrove platform team. Do not use for routine maintenance. Break-glass unlocks via a single-use console that requires the recovery passphrase stored directly below.

unlock words, bahop-fawef: novmir-druwyn-soriel-rusdor-kasion